
Paperback
Published 14 Jul 2016
- $10.40
9 results
Paperback
Published 14 Jul 2016
Paperback
Published 01 Sep 2014
$0.47off
Paperback
Published 31 Mar 2013
Save $0.47
$6.97off
Hardback
Published 14 Mar 2023
Save $6.97
Paperback
Published 07 Jul 2015
Paperback
Published 28 Dec 2019
Paperback
Published 27 Mar 2014
Paperback
Published 09 Jun 2017
Hardback
Published 14 Feb 2018